#177891 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#177891 is composed of 9% red, 47.1%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 17.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 192.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 32.9%. #177891 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ef0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#177891 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#177891 has RGB values of R:23, G:120,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 1538193.

Shades and Tints of #177891
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02080a is the darkest color, while #f8f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#177891
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515657 is the less saturated color, while #0483a4 is the most saturated one.
